Citat:
Originalno napisao degojs
Ajoj, al je taj što je to pisao blesav..
Priča o apstrakciji a onda kaže da će da menja SQL kverije. Pa kakvi SQL upiti ako koristiš upravo apstrakciju? Pa on ne razume uopšte ni pola priče.. Koja glupost. Pa ti sistemu treba da kažeš koju bazu koristiš da bi on mogao da koristi kod specifičan za tu bazu, a ne.. da abstraction layer nekom magijom ima SQL kod koji radi na svim bazama. Svašta. Već sam napisao pre, može da se koristi Factory dp.
Dalje nisam ni čitao.
|
Covek prica o Pear: DB i AdoDB, najpopularnijim abstraction layerima za PHP, i u jednom i u drugom se pisu SQL queriji direktno... tako da ne prica on gluposti nego ti ne znas kako se to radi u php-u...
Da si procitao ceo text video bi da se prica o ideji da je (po njemu) pogresno bazu asptrakovati tabelu po tabelu, ili query po query, nego treba apstrakcija da bude zasnovana na prirodi entiteta sa kojim radis, tipa imas recimo klasu User i sve sa njom radis, a ne zanima te da li userove podatke cuvas u jednoj ili 5 tabela, to je pitanje implementacije same klase i zavisi, izmedju ostalog i od tipa baze...
to je u stvari ista fora kao da imas View u bazi koji ti joinuje sve podatke za Usera, pa sa njim radis...tebe ne zanima odakle ti podaci dolaze u View, samo te interesuje koje se polje kako zove....